What do covalent bonds and ionic bonds have in common?

What do covalent bonds and ionic bonds have in common? The most obvious similarity is that the result is the same: Both ionic and covalent bonding lead to the creation of stable molecules. … For ionic bonding, valence electrons are gained or lost to form a charged ion, and in covalent bonding, the valence electrons are shared directly.

What is not included in a net ionic equation? In the net ionic equation, any ions that do not participate in the reaction (called spectator ions) are excluded. As a result, the net ionic equation shows only the species that are actually involved in the chemical reaction.

What reactions form precipitates? Precipitation reactions are usually double displacement reactions involving the production of a solid form residue called the precipitate. These reactions also occur when two or more solutions with different salts are combined, resulting in the formation of insoluble salts that precipitate out of the solution.

How do you know if a reaction is a precipitate? We would expect them to undergo a double displacement reaction with each other. By examining the solubility rules we see that, while most sulfates are soluble, barium sulfate is not. Because it is insoluble in water we know that it is the precipitate.

How can you determine whether a compound is ionic?

If a compound is made from a metal and a non-metal, its bonding will be ionic. If a compound is made from two non-metals, its bonding will be covalent.

What is ionic size in chemistry?

Explanation: The ionic size is when the atom loses or gains electrons to become negatively charged (anions) or positively charged (cations) ions. When atoms lose or gain electrons, the size of the ion is not the same as the original atom.

Which statement about ionic compounds is true?

Which is true of ionic compounds? They are made of metals and nonmetals is true of ionic compounds. They usually form between elements on opposite sides of the periodic table. Ionic compounds are only good conductors when molten or dissolved.

Do not use prefixes to name ionic compounds?

When naming binary ionic compounds, name the cation first (specifying the charge, if necessary), then the nonmetal anion (element stem + -ide). Do NOT use prefixes to indicate how many of each element is present; this information is implied in the name of the compound. since iron can form more than one charge.

Does ionic bonds increase the stability of atoms?

Ionic bonding is a type of chemical bond in which valence electrons are lost from one atom and gained by another. This exchange results in a more stable, noble gas electronic configuration for both atoms involved.

What is the roman numeral in an ionic compound?

The Roman numeral denotes the charge and the oxidation state of the transition metal ion. For example, iron can form two common ions, Fe2+ and Fe3+. To distinguish the difference, Fe2+ would be named iron (II) and Fe3+ would be named iron (III).

What is the distinction between electronic and ionic conduction?

The key difference between electronic and ionic conduction is that electronic conduction is the movement of electrons from one place to another, whereas ionic conduction is the movement of ions from one place to another.

Is an ionic compound an ion?

Ionic compounds contain ions and are held together by the attractive forces among the oppositely charged ions. Common salt (sodium chloride) is one of the best-known ionic compounds.

Can two oxygen atoms form ionic bonds?

Could two atoms of oxygen engage in ionic bonding? Why or why not? Identical atoms have identical electronegativity and cannot form ionic bonds. Oxygen, for example, has six electrons in its valence shell.

What is the charge of ionic compounds?

Ionic compounds contain positively and negatively charged ions in a ratio that results in an overall charge of zero.

Why are ionic compounds hard?

The ionic compounds are usually hard because the ions are held by strong electrostatic force of attraction as the positive and negative ions are strongly attracted to each other and difficult to separate them apart.

What happens when an ionic substance dissolves in water?

When ionic compounds dissolve in water, the ions in the solid separate and disperse uniformly throughout the solution because water molecules surround and solvate the ions, reducing the strong electrostatic forces between them. This process represents a physical change known as dissociation.
